Transaction 4e88e7057c231ca18318591ae03152636ca7c0f0af3837b129af3aa83912955c

1 Input
2 Outputs
  • 4e88e7057c231ca18318591ae03152636ca7c0f0af3837b129af3aa83912955c:0
  • value  2140515293
    address  muB7X4PFBat7vfRQUUM9XF19qcvfJg9cGY
  • 4e88e7057c231ca18318591ae03152636ca7c0f0af3837b129af3aa83912955c:1
  • value  27500000
    address  2MuQUhQ3HcgxGuAcQdDufRpLmgarLta83Nc